Highly Specialist Dietitian - Learning Disabilities and Mental Health

Bradford Teaching Hospitals NHS Foundation Trust
Full time Full day
£43,742 - £50,056 / year
Bradford
Bradford Nutrition and Dietetic Service



An exciting opportunity has arisen for an experienced and forward thinking dietitian, looking to develop their leadership and management skills, to join our learning disability and mental health team.



Bradford’s Nutrition & Dietetic Service is a dynamic team of over 60 Dietitians working in Acute, Community and Primary Care settings, supported by an excellent clerical team with good IT and library facilities.



Bradford is a vibrant, diverse, multicultural city with a wide range of entertainment and leisure activities available locally. There are good road and rail networks to Leeds and the M62 corridor, and easy access to the Yorkshire Dales and the South Pennines



You will join a growing team of dietitians/specialist dietitians and dietetic assistant practitioners providing specialist community learning disability (including enteral feeding) and in-patient/out-reach mental health services within our partner organisation Bradford District Care NHS Foundation Trust (BDCFT).



You will provide clinical supervision and day to day management and support to dietetic colleagues. You will hold a specialist clinical caseload and recent relevant experience in either learning disabilities or mental health is therefore essential.



You will work closely with multi-disciplinary teams in the specialist service areas. You will have a drive to develop yourself and others to improve patient care and will seek opportunities to lead on service improvement and deliver the values of Bradford Nutrition and Dietetic Services – Leading Nutrition, Valuing People and Showing Our Worth.



Applicants must be HCPC registered dietitians, who have obtained relevant clinical dietetic experience and who are car drivers with access to a car to meet the requirement for regular travel across organisational sites (reasonable adjustments will be considered)

This post embodies the Bradford District and Craven 'Act as One' principle of how we work together across health and care organisations and is a well-established and growing partnership between the Nutrition and Dietetic Service of BTHFT and BDCFT.



You will be supported by the clinical lead dietitian for LD/MH and the Principal Dietitian for Outreach Services and your personal development will be fully supported.



We are an agile and digitally enabled team working across community and in-patient sites with an element of home working also supported. The post is offered at full-time with part time applications also considered - please indicate your preferred working hours in the supporting information of your application.



You will have line management responsibilities and we are looking for a supportive and engaging leader who can develop and grow our team of dietitians.



You will fully participate in the training of ‘B’ and ‘C’ Placement student dietitians including undertaking the role of assessor.
